Clinton Lawsuit Threat Is to Stop Texas Caucus Results Reporting

Al Giordano,The Field

In a conference call that began around 9:10 a.m. and just ended, Obama campaign manager David Plouffe explained the Texas Democratic Party’s letter of yesterday as being a response to lawsuit threats by the Clinton campaign:


“They do not want the caucus results reported Tuesday night. The thought of timely reporting of those results is causing them deep anxiety.”

Imagine that: The legal threats are about whether the people know, or not, the results of their own voting at caucuses. Well, at least we know what the threats are about now.


“To suggest that you have trouble with the results of Texas caucuses being reported, that’s over 60 delegates,” Plouffe said, “it’s a big part of the picture that night. They need to win Texas and Ohio by at least ten points and they are going to fail by that measure.”
